Install A Tippmann Model 98 Paintball Gun Vertical Adapter

Tippmann didn't design a good way to connect a regulator or expansion chamber for their model 98 paintball gun. To be able to attach either of those products you have to use a vertical adapter. Setting up a vertical adapter may seem tricky but really will use effortlessly.


Instructions


1. Buy a vertical adapter package for the Tippmann model 98 paintball gun.


2. Remove all air sources and paintballs in the gun.


3. Remove the hopper and elbow along with the barrel.


4. Contain the cocking knob and pull the trigger. Permit the knob to slip forward gradually to not-cock the gun.


5. Make use of an allen wrench to get rid of the 2 screws at the base from the gun holding the ASA in position.


6. Unscrew the 2 grip screws holding the left grip after which take away the six body screws. This allows the 2 body halves to slip apart.


7. Spot the two screws in the center of the best body half near in which the valve is, remove both of these screws then pull the valve out of the body.


8. Disconnect the braided stainless line in the valve utilizing a wrench.


9. Wrap pipe sealing tape round the vertical plugs connection and screw it in to the valve.


10. Put the valve using the vertical adapter linked to it in to the gun, and switch the two screws that contain the valve in position.


11. Close the marker within the reverse order it had been taken apart.
